  • Amin Esmaeilnejad Announces Departure from Skra Bełchatów: What’s Next for the Star Player?

    Amin Esmaeilnejad, the Iranian international opposite spiker, is set to leave Polish volleyball team Skra Bełchatów after the current season, alongside Bulgarian Radoslav Parapunov. This transition raises questions about the team’s future dynamics. Esmaeilnejad, 28, joined Skra Bełchatów from Italy’s Rana Verona and is a key player for the Iranian national team, especially with upcoming competitions in 2025. The Iranian Volleyball Federation has appointed Italian coach Roberto Piazza, aiming to enhance team performance. With significant changes ahead, both Esmaeilnejad’s career trajectory and Skra Bełchatów’s roster will be crucial to watch in the coming months.

  • Iran U-23 Football Team Triumphs Over Hong Kong in Thrilling Friendly Showdown

    Iran’s U-23 football team recently defeated Hong Kong in a friendly match in Abu Dhabi, serving as crucial preparation for the AFC U-23 Asian Cup Saudi Arabia 2026 Qualifiers. Coach Omid Ravankhah leads the team, which aims to make a significant impact in the upcoming qualification matches. Iran will face Hong Kong again on September 2, followed by Guam and the United Arab Emirates on September 6 and 9, respectively. With 44 teams competing for 11 group spots in the final tournament, this qualification round is vital for young players to showcase their talent and secure future opportunities in football.

  • Iran Triumphs Over Japan in Thrilling 2025 FIBA Asia Cup Showdown!

    In an exciting 2025 FIBA Asia Cup matchup, Iran defeated Japan 78-70 at King Abdullah Sports City in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ia. This victory, following their win against Guam, positions Iran at a 2-0 record in Group B. Mohammad Amini led Iran with 24 points, 8 rebounds, and 3 steals, while Sina Vahedi added 22 points, crucial for a late-game surge. Joshua Hawkinson contributed a double-double with 20 points and 17 rebounds. Japan’s Keisei Tominaga was their top scorer with 22 points but faced foul trouble. Iran’s next challenge is against Syria, promising another thrilling game.

  • Esteghlal Secures Star Signing: Abolfazl Zoleykhaei Joins the Team!

    Esteghlal football club has signed 18-year-old defender Abolfazl Zoleykhaei on a five-year contract, aiming to strengthen their defense as they currently sit 10th in the Iran football league. Zoleykhaei, a member of the Iran U-20 team, brings potential and skill, showcasing his abilities at an international level. Esteghlal’s management believes his speed and tactical awareness will help improve the team’s performance. This signing reflects the club’s strategy of focusing on youth development to build a competitive future. Fans are eager to see Zoleykhaei’s impact as Esteghlal seeks to climb the league standings.
